    Inn Details

    Located in the heart of the beautiful Monte Vista Historical District is a magnificent two-story, award-winning Italian Villa surrounded by lush gardens, a 45-foot swimming pool and a full rooftop patio which overlooks downtown San Antonio.

    Signature Dish

    Stuffed French Toast
    Thick French toast is split and stuffed with a mixture of cream cheese and pecans is then covered with an orange-apricot sauce.

    The Bonner Garden B&B is located in the safe and beautiful Monte Vista neighborhood near Trinity University, 15 minutes drive from the airport, and less from downtown. There are coffee shops and restaurants in the area, and we could walk to the northern part of the River Walk in 25 minutes (it's another 20 minutes walk to downtown). The Bonner Garden hosts were friendly and were very happy to accommodate our vegetarian diet. Our room was sunny, clean, and comfortable. A very classy place--I'd stay there again.
